Armscor is seeking a service provider to design, supply, install, test, commission, and hand over a plc workbench at the armscor dockyard in simonstown, western cape. The tender is a request for quotation (RFQ) with a closing date of 20 august 2026, and bidders must submit electronically via email. The evaluation will consider price (80 points) and specific goals (20 points) under the 80/20 preference point system.
- Submit electronically via email to [email protected] On or before the closing date and time. - Do not copy (cc) or blind copy any other armscor official β doing so will automatically disqualify your quotation. - Submit in pdf format protected from modifications, deletions, or additions. - Keep financial/pricing information in a separate attachment from the technical/functional response. - Mark all submissions prominently with the RFQ number and bidder's name. - Email at least one hour before closing to avoid transmission delays; late emails will not be accepted. - Armscor is not responsible for transmission failures, file size issues, illegibility, or security of bid data. - Include all mandatory documents; the onus is on the bidder to ensure completeness. - Quotation must remain valid for 90 days from bid closing date. - Complete the returnable schedule annexure with a yes/no checklist for each required document. - Provide a separate quotation on company letterhead clearly outlining item description, unit of measure, quantities, unit price, and total price per line item. - Indicate delivery address: armscor dockyard, transit store, cole point, east yard, st george's street, simon's town. - State period required for commencement of delivery and completion of order after receipt of order. - Provide supplier number and unique csd registration reference number. - Provide SARS pin (implies permission for armscor to verify tax status) or original tax clearance certificate. - Register for security on the armscor website to be considered for orders administered by armscor soc. - Classified quotations must follow armscor security instruction A-WI-014 (obtainable from contractor security section, p o box 411, pretoria, 0001).
George municipality is inviting tenders from cidb-registered electrical contractors to be appointed to a panel for the execution of capital projects, specifically electrical reticulation works in informal settlement areas, on an as-and-when-required basis until 30 june 2029. The tender is open to contractors with a CIDB grading of 2ep, 3ep, or 4ep or higher, and requires a compulsory briefing session and strict compliance with eligibility, functionality, and preference procurement criteria.
- Submit completed tender in a sealed envelope, clearly marked with: tender NO. GMT014/25-26. - place tender in the tender box at george municipality, fifth floor, directorate: financial services, supply chain management unit, civic centre, york street, george by NO later than 12:00 on thursday, 20 august 2026. - Late or unmarked tenders will not be considered. - NO tenders via fax or email will be accepted. - All documents listed in part t1 and part t2 of the tender document must be fully completed, signed where applicable, and submitted as a complete set. - Only hard-copied tender documents will be accepted. - Tender documents are available at a non-refundable deposit of r309.35 From the supply chain management unit or free on the george municipality website: www.george.gov.za. - Attendance at the compulsory briefing session is required; non-attendance will disqualify your tender.
Kannaland municipality invites suppliers to submit bids for the once-off supply and delivery of air dac and strain clamps, critical electrical components. This tender is open to compliant suppliers who can meet the technical, financial, and compliance requirements for a single delivery to ladismith.
Submit bids via email to [email protected] By the closing date and time (09 june 2026 at 12:00). Late, faxed, or emailed submissions after the deadline will not be accepted. Use the official forms provided (mbd 1, mbd 3.1, Mbd 4, mbd 5, mbd 6.1, Mbd 6.2, Mbd 7.1, Mbd 8, mbd 9) and do not re-type them. The original tender document must be completed in black ink and signed by an authorized signatory. Missing pages or unauthorized alterations will disqualify the bid. All required documents (e.g., SARS tax compliance pin, b-bbee certificate, csd registration, municipal account, joint venture agreement if applicable) must be submitted. Bidders must confirm completion of all bidding forms in the checklist. Failure to comply with submission rules (e.g., Incomplete forms, missing signatures, or unauthorized changes) will result in disqualification. Faxed or late submissions are not accepted. Bids must remain valid for 90 days after the closing date.
